When I was trying -L argument, I found that the deployment will be rejected if I assign the lambda version with v1.0.0, and then I figure out the version will be appended to the function name which makes the function name being illegal.

As AWS Lambda mentioned in the CreateFunction API document, function name only allows [a-zA-Z0-9-_]+, any disallowed character will be replaced with _ by this PR.
